The historic 87,000-acre Chico Basin Ranch is one of Colorado's premier family owned and managed cattle ranching operations. It is the year round home to owners Duke and Janet Phillips and their four children, Tess, Duke, Julie and Grace. All family members are involved in the care of as many as 3,000 head of cattle and the teeming wildlife that they share the ranch with. It is one of the largest and most beautiful and pristine ranches in the nation. It has six spring-fed lakes filled with wild fish, bull rushes and cattails. Two creeks meander through the entire ranch, fed by hundreds of springs that bubble out of the ground forming pools of sparkling water scattered over the prairie. The ranch is in the shadow of snow capped 14,000-foot Pikes Peak that rises up through the clouds, crowning the Rocky Mountains that stretch clear across the western horizon.
This exclusive vacation spot limits the number of families or groups per week to two. This is to ensure that each guest receives the required attention to create the ultimate experience. Limiting the number of guests is also important to the Phillips because it maintains the atmosphere of what it truly is: a real life working cattle ranch. The Phillips take a personal interest in getting to know all of their guests, sharing meals in their own home, riding together to work cattle, or simply spending time visiting in the evenings after a full day on the ranch.
Guests have the option of participating in all activities on the ranch and can emphasize whatever aspect they wish, whether it be horseback riding, herding, penning or another activity such as swimming, fly fishing or hiking. Because there are so many cattle that require everyday horseback work, guests can always be on horseback. Additionally, the Phillips have found that people come to the ranch because of its great cow horses. Naturally, guests are interested in improving their horsemanship skills. Each day there are training sessions that teach guests natural horsemanship techniques that the ranch uses, based on the work of a man named Ray Hunt.
